374506
00000000000000000328c26e90320e0a32ba9a41e4d8c7aba5bd9cc1aa6b2b76
Time
09-14-2015 23:55:20 (Local)
Sponsored
Size
998086 Bytes
Transaction Fees
0.39716594
BTC
Confirmations
555860
Total Amounts
19804.74523761 BTC
Mining Difficulty
56957648455.01001
Transaction Counts
2025
Previous Block:
Merkle Root:
be3d81af1608107248103d93daf933ab3f6e42c750c995f7aee139ae7bc25865
Mined By:
APIs